How they compare
Pakistan currently reports 7,298 millions against 6,429 millions in Qatar, a difference of 869 millions.
That makes Pakistan's figure about 1.1 times Qatar's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 19 shared years of data; in 1971 it was Pakistan ahead.
Pakistan ranks 51st and Qatar ranks 53rd of 174 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Pakistan averaged higher in 3 and Qatar in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Pakistan | Qatar |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 781.15 millions | 397.07 millions | 384.07 millions | Pakistan |
| 1990s | 3,679 millions | 1,792 millions | 1,887 millions | Pakistan |
| 2000s | 3,611 millions | 2,888 millions | 723.05 millions | Pakistan |
| 2010s | 5,789 millions | 6,554 millions | 764.85 millions | Qatar |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
